Abstract:

In this commentary, I reflect on 12 stories from individuals who have had a near-death experience, and I describe how the ministry of the spiritual caregiver can aide patients who experience a near-death phenomenon. Spiritual care providers are trained to support patients and family members and promote a sense of peace and comfort. They offer affirmation while promoting a space for wondering. Spiritual health is an essential component of a whole-body system. The experiences of the 12 authors have much in common, but perhaps most surprising is the omission of any clergy or chaplains being called on despite many of the authors disclosing their NDE to physicians and nurses.
